Don't know about what's the right component, though. This is the second of (at least) two special cases of a response reminder: 1. Remind me, so I don't forget to answer a received mail. 2. Remind me, so I don't forget to insist on a response to a mail send by myself. Both could be realized with some special preset of a new To-do/Reminder item minimizing user interaction. So basically such presets are what we need. (This could perfectly integrate with some kind of auto-reminder feature, which would be based on filter actions. Actually, any kind of automation requires sensible presets reducing user interaction.
